How much do social security j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 15, 2026, the average yearly pay for social security in San Ramon, CA is $85,228.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$65,900.00 and $102,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of a Social Security specialist?

A Social Security Specialist’s day usually involves reviewing and processing benefit applications, verifying eligibility, and assisting clients with questions about retirement, disability, and survivor benefits. They spend time communicating directly with individuals by phone, email, or in-person to clarify requirements and gather necessary documentation. Specialists often collaborate with other government agencies or departments to resolve complex cases or facilitate service delivery. Because the work often involves handling personal and sensitive information, maintaining confidentiality and accuracy is essential. The environment is generally structured, with set procedures and regular performance benchmarks.

What is a Social Security?

A Social Security job typically involves working for the Social Security Administration (SSA) or a related agency, helping people access retirement, disability, and survivor benefits. Employees may process claims, provide customer service, manage records, or investigate fraud. Roles range from administrative and technical positions to legal and policy-focused jobs. These positions require knowledge of Social Security laws and regulations, and they often involve interacting with the public to ensure they receive the benefits they qualify for.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Social Security position, and why are they important?

To excel in a Social Security Representative or Specialist role, you need a thorough understanding of federal and state Social Security regulations, strong analytical skills, and experience processing claims or benefits. Familiarity with government case management systems, document management software, and occasional use of specialized databases is important. Exceptional customer service skills, patience, and attention to detail help professionals navigate sensitive client situations and complex paperwork. These capabilities are crucial to delivering accurate guidance, ensuring compliance, and providing supportive service to the public.

Job description


Job Description:
As a Protective Security Officer, you will be responsible for maintaining the safety and security of federally owned, leased, or occupied facilities protected by the Federal Protective Service. This includes monitoring surveillance equipment, inspecting buildings and access points, permitting entry, and responding to emergencies.
Key Responsibilities:
• Maintain a secure environment by monitoring and controlling access to the facility.
• Conduct regular patrols of the premises to ensure safety and security.
• Respond promptly to alarms, emergencies, and incidents, assisting as needed.
• Enforce security protocols and procedures to prevent unauthorized access.
• Prepare and submit reports on activities and incidents.
• Conduct personnel and vehicle screening.
• Provide first aid and assist first responders as needed.
• Operate security equipment and perform patrols.
Requirements
Requirements
Minimum Requirements:
  • CANDIDATE MUST HAVE GOOD CREDIT, NO EXCESSIVE LATE PAYMENTS OR COLLECTIONS

• Must be a United States citizen or a Lawful Permanent Resident with verifiable honorable discharge from any component of the United StatesArmed Forces.
• Must have been issued a Social Security Card by the Social Security Administration.
• Must be at least 21 years of age.
• High school diploma or GED from an accredited institution.
• A minimum of two years of security (armed) or one year of law enforcement experience in a full-duty status with a full-service policedepartment in a municipality, state, or federal law enforcement department within the US, or two years of honorable service as a member ofany US Armed Forces component.
• Ability to speak, read, comprehend, and compose written reports in English.
• Must pass a background check and obtain the necessary security clearance.
• Must possess and maintain a valid driver's license and firearm license/permit.
Ability to pass a medical examination and meet physical requirements.
